According to Odaily, Ethereum co-founder Vitalik Buterin recently proposed on social media that developers should consider the possibility that the current 32 ETH staking requirement is a higher barrier for stakers than bandwidth requirements. He suggested that slightly increasing the bandwidth requirement in exchange for lowering the minimum staking deposit to 16 or 24 ETH could benefit both staking accessibility and scale. Buterin further mentioned that once Ethereum completes the peerdas upgrade, bandwidth requirements would decrease, and with the completion of orbit SSF, the minimum deposit could be reduced to as low as 1 ETH.
